Prepare the salmon

Start by choosing fresh, high-quality salmon. You’ll need about a pound of salmon fillet for this recipe, cut into bite-sized pieces—aim for about 1-2 inches wide.

  • Removing Skin: If your salmon has skin, you may wish to remove it for a more tender bite.
  • Bite Size: The key here is to cut uniformly; this ensures even cooking. As a bonus, smaller pieces absorb flavors better!

Once cut, pat the pieces dry with a paper towel to help coatings stick better and maintain crispness during cooking.

Make the bang bang sauce

The magic of bang bang sauce is its creamy, slightly spicy flavor that perfectly complements the salmon. Making the sauce is a breeze:

  • Ingredients: You will need mayonnaise, chili sauce (like Sriracha or a similar sweet chili sauce), and a splash of lime juice.
  1. In a bowl, combine ½ cup mayonnaise, ¼ cup chili sauce, and 1 tablespoon lime juice.
  2. Mix well and taste—feel free to tweak by adding more chili for heat or a touch more lime for brightness.

Coat the salmon bites

Now that you have your salmon ready and the sauce made, it’s time to bring them together:

  • Dredging Setup: Create a dredging station using a bowl and a plate:

    • In one bowl, add some seasoned panko breadcrumbs (for extra crunch!).
    • In another, put the bang bang sauce you just made.
  • Dip each salmon bite first into the sauce, ensuring it’s coated well, then roll it in the panko breadcrumbs.

This method maximizes flavor and texture—no sogginess here!

Preheat the air fryer

Before popping those bang bang salmon bites into the air fryer, preheat it to 400°F (200°C) for about 5 minutes. This is an essential step for achieving that golden, crispy exterior.

  • Why Preheat? Preheating helps the salmon bites cook evenly and keeps that crispy coating intact, similar to a deep-fried finish but much healthier.

Air fry the salmon bites

Now comes the fun part! It’s time to air fry those bites:

  1. Batch Cooking: Depending on the size of your air fryer, you may need to cook in batches. Place the coated salmon bites in a single layer, leaving space for air to circulate.

  2. Cooking Time: Air fry for about 8-10 minutes, flipping halfway through. You’ll know they’re ready when the outside looks crispy and golden brown, and the salmon has flaked easily with a fork.

Bang Bang Tofu Bites

For a plant-based twist, tofu is your best friend. This variation is not only vegan but also incredibly easy to whip up. Start by pressing and cubing your tofu, then marinate it in the same bang bang sauce. Just like our salmon bites, a crispy coating really elevates the dish.

  • Tips for Tofu: Use extra-firm tofu for better texture and toss it in cornstarch before air frying for that perfect crunch.
  • Cooking Time: Air fry these tofu bites for about 12 minutes at 375°F, shaking the basket halfway through for even crispiness.

Cooking tips and notes for Air Fryer Bang Bang Salmon Bites

Choosing the best salmon

When it comes to making air fryer bang bang salmon bites, quality matters. Look for wild-caught salmon if possible; it’s not only healthier but also provides incredible flavor. Sustainability is key, so check resources like the Monterey Bay Seafood Watch for guides on choosing the best options.

Achieving crispy bites

To get those perfectly crispy bites, don’t overcrowd your air fryer. Give each piece enough space for the hot air to circulate. You might also consider lightly dusting the salmon with cornstarch or panko before air frying. This technique can elevate the texture, resulting in a delightful crunch that complements the creamy bang bang sauce.

Storing leftovers

If you happen to have leftovers (which is rare because they are so delicious!), store them in an airtight container in the fridge. To reheat, pop them back into the air fryer for a few minutes to regain that crispy texture. Don’t microwave them; no one likes soggy salmon bites! FAQ about Air Fryer Bang Bang Salmon Bites

Can I use frozen salmon for this recipe?

Absolutely! Using frozen salmon for your air fryer bang bang salmon bites is a convenient option. Just ensure you thaw it properly before cooking. You can do this by leaving it in the fridge overnight or sealing it in a plastic bag and submerging it in cold water for about an hour. Cooking times may vary slightly, so keep an eye on them to achieve that perfect crispy texture.

What do I do if I don’t have an air fryer?

No air fryer? No problem! You can easily make bang bang salmon bites in your oven.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). After preparing your salmon bites, place them on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Bake for about 12-15 minutes or until they’re golden and cooked through. Air Fryer Bang Bang Salmon Bites: Easy and Irresistibly Crispy

Deliciously crispy salmon bites made effortlessly in an air fryer, perfect for a quick meal or appetizer.

  • Author: Souzan
  • Prep Time: 15 minutes
  • Cook Time: 10 minutes
  • Total Time: 25 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x
  • Category: Appetizer
  • Method: Air Fryer
  • Cuisine: American
  • Diet: Gluten-Free

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 pound salmon fillets
  • 1/2 cup panko bread crumbs
  • 1/4 cup all-purpose flour
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1/4 cup sweet chili sauce
  • 1 tablespoon sriracha

Instructions

  1. Preheat the air fryer to 400°F (200°C).
  2. Cut the salmon fillets into bite-sized pieces.
  3. In a bowl, mix the panko breadcrumbs, flour, garlic powder, paprika, salt, and black pepper.
  4. In another bowl, whisk the eggs and olive oil together.
  5. Dip each salmon piece into the egg mixture, then coat with the breadcrumb mixture.
  6. Place the salmon bites in the air fryer basket in a single layer.
  7. Cook for 8-10 minutes or until golden brown and crispy.
  8. In a small bowl, mix the sweet chili sauce and sriracha together for the sauce.
  9. Serve the salmon bites with the sauce on the side.

Notes

  • Adjust the amounts of sriracha based on your heat preference.
  • For extra crunch, spray the bites lightly with cooking spray before air frying.
